From: Trauma-induced coagulopathy and critical bleeding: the role of plasma and platelet transfusion

Mortality of massively transfused patients at 24Â h stratified by platelet ratio. Adjusted for hypotension on admission (90 vs. 90Â mmHg), GCS on admission (8 vs. 8), FFP/RBC ratio (%) at 24Â h, and cryoprecipitate at 24Â h. FFP fresh frozen plasma, GCS Glasgow Coma Scale, RBC red blood cell
